13 references to XmlAtomicValue
System.Private.Xml (13)
System\Xml\Schema\XmlValueConverter.cs (6)
1268if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(SchemaType!, (double)value)); 1269if (destinationType == XPathItemType) return (new XmlAtomicValue(SchemaType!, (double)value)); 1302if (sourceType == DoubleType) return (new XmlAtomicValue(SchemaType!, (double)value)); 1309if (sourceType == DoubleType) return (new XmlAtomicValue(SchemaType!, (double)value)); 2713if (destinationType == XmlAtomicValueType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Double), (double)value)); 2798if (sourceType == DoubleType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Double), (double)value));
System\Xml\Xsl\Runtime\XmlILStorageConverter.cs (2)
56return new XmlAtomicValue(runtime.GetXmlType(index).SchemaType, value); 61return new XmlAtomicValue(runtime.GetXmlType(index).SchemaType, value);
System\Xml\Xsl\Runtime\XmlQueryRuntime.cs (1)
640value = new XmlQueryItemSequence(new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Double), ((IConvertible)value).ToDouble(null)));
System\Xml\Xsl\Runtime\XsltConvert.cs (3)
283return new XmlAtomicValue(destinationType.SchemaType, ToDouble(value)); 286return new XmlAtomicValue(destinationType.SchemaType, ToDouble((decimal)value.ValueAs(typeof(decimal), null))); 290return new XmlAtomicValue(destinationType.SchemaType, ToDouble(value.ValueAsLong));
System\Xml\Xsl\Runtime\XsltFunctions.cs (1)
221case "version": return new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Double), 1.0);